copyright Recovery: Understanding Suspensions and How to Appeal

Experiencing an copyright suspension can be incredibly disheartening, but this is often fixable . Accounts are typically banned due to infringements of eBay's guidelines, which could involve issues like prohibited items , selling fake merchandise , or payment problems . To unlock your account, you generally need to file an appeal using eBay's account recovery process, meticulously explaining the situation and proving that you've understand the guidelines and won't repeat the offending behavior. A clear and courteous appeal, including any pertinent documentation, significantly increases your probability of a favorable outcome. Remember to examine your copyright record before beginning the appeal.
